Pet Shop Boys - one in a million, 1993

"This song boasts a common, tried-and-true pop music device, though it's not at all common for PSB. In fact, it's downright rare for them: a climactic key change. Virtually a cliché in the work of some artists—just try to find a Barry Manilow single that doesn't raise its key near the end—it would appear that the Pet Shop Boys have assiduously avoided it. But not in "One in a Million." Its climactic key change in the final repetitions of the chorus does precisely what climactic key changes are meant to do: push the energy up a couple of notches, imparting an epic feel to the proceedings. Coming as it does, a rarity in a PSB track, it's nothing less than thrilling to hear."
